Hardware Probe is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server. Hardware probe for performance diagnostics, thermal monitoring, and LLM optimization. Install with: npx -y @yamaru-eu/hardware-probe. Source: https://github.com/yamaru-eu/hardware-probe. Compatible with MCP clients such as Claude Desktop, Cursor, Cline and Windsurf.
